Police Recover Body of Missing 3-Year-Old in Mamaroneck River

The body of a 3-year-old boy was recovered by Village of Mamaroneck Police on Thursday, law enforcement officials reported.

The tot was reported missing around 2:30 p.m. on Feb. 27, police said, after the child’s 54-year-old uncle and 85-year-old grandfather couldn’t locate him themselves.

Cops came to investigate and search the area, and later found the 3-year-old’s body near the Hillside Avenue Bridge in the Village of Mamaroneck. The child was pronounced dead on the scene.

According to the Village of Mamaroneck Police Department, detectives concluded that the child left his home around 12:12 p.m. on Feb. 27 with the family dog. The 3-year-old apparently headed to the Mamaroneck River near First Street – just two blocks from his house – and likely fell in, drowned, and was carried downstream.

The Westchester County Medical Examiner’s Office responded to the scene and took possession of the child’s body, according to the Village of Mamaroneck Police.

The investigation is still ongoing.
